How to hire a motorhome

When it comes to motorhome hire in the UK, there are several companies to choose from. However, not all rental companies offer the same level of service and quality. The motorhome rental site Goboony for example, specialises in luxury rental motorhomes, ideal for groups or families that wish to travel with all the home comforts but without a massive price tag. To ensure a smooth and enjoyable experience, it’s crucial to conduct thorough research before making a decision.

Start by reading independent reviews on platforms like Trustpilot to gain insights into the experiences of previous customers. You can also join motorhome-related Facebook groups to seek feedback and recommendations from experienced motorhome owners about what to look out for when you want to hire a motorhome.

Once you have narrowed down your choices, carefully review the rental contracts and terms provided by each company. Only commit to the rental when you are 100% satisfied with the conditions.

Why a motorhome

Converted panel vans, such as VW or Ford Transit models, are perfect for short breaks and small families, accommodating up to four adults. With a campervan, you can enjoy the feeling of driving a large car while benefiting from better fuel efficiency. But if you’re looking for more space and amenities, you might want to hire a motorhome. 

Motorhomes typically come with a wider range of features, including showers, toilets and ovens, providing a more home-like experience on the road. With a five or seven-berth motorhome, families or those planning longer breaks can enjoy comfortable sleeping arrangements and added conveniences. It’s important to note that driving a motorhome requires confidence, as these vehicles are larger and heavier than campervans.

The costs of motorhome hire in the UK

Before diving into a motorhome hire in the UK, it’s essential to have a clear understanding of the costs involved. The price of renting a motorhome in the UK can vary depending on the model, size of the vehicle and the time of year you plan to travel.

During the summer months, the price to hire a motorhome typically ranges from £750 to £1500 per week. If you’re looking for a more budget-friendly option, campervan rental costs are usually on the lower end of the scale.

Making the most of your motorhome hire in the UK

To fully enjoy your experience when you hire a motorhome, make sure you are well-prepared and organized before setting off on your adventure. Although reputable motorhome rental companies provide the basics for cooking and daily living, there are personal items and essentials you should pack to ensure a comfortable journey. Here’s a checklist to guide you:

  1. Personal clothes and toiletries (pack light to save space).
     
  2. Lightweight sleeping bags suitable for the motorhome’s beds.
     
  3. Microfiber quick-drying towels to save space.
     
  4. A day-to-day first aid kit for minor injuries.
     
  5. Loo roll (choose thinner options for easy disposal).
     
  6. Anti-bacterial wipes for cleaning surfaces around the toilet and hose.
     
  7. Kitchen roll, dishcloths, tea towels and basic cleaning supplies.
     
  8. Specialist toilet chemicals for motorhome toilets.
     
  9. A car phone charger to keep devices charged on the move.
     
  10. A washing line and pegs for outdoor drying.
     
  11. Indoor activities for entertainment in case of bad weather.
     
  12. Useful motorhome apps downloaded before departure.

Driving a motorhome

Driving a motorhome is a different experience compared to driving a regular car or even a campervan. It requires a bit of adjustment and practice to get used to the vehicle’s size and handling.

Take your time and start with motorways or main roads in open countryside to get a feel for the motorhome’s swing at the back and how it responds to strong winds. When you hire a motorhome get one with a reversing camera or rear parking sensors to assist with parking manoeuvres if possible.

Motorhome systems

Understanding and managing the various systems in your motorhome is essential for a hassle-free trip. Familiarize yourself with the motorhome’s toilet, water, gas and electrical systems before setting off.

Arriving on site

When you arrive at a campsite, take the time to learn how to access and manage the motorhome’s fresh and waste water tanks and empty the toilet cassette. Don’t hesitate to seek help from fellow motorhome owners if needed; they are usually friendly and willing to offer assistance.

Motorhome cooking and meals

One of the joys of motorhome hire in the UK is the opportunity to cook your meals and enjoy them in beautiful surroundings. However, with limited kitchen space, it’s essential to be organized and focus on one-pot dishes. Outdoor cooking can be enjoyable too, and investing in a small portable gas BBQ can enhance your culinary experiences.
